VMLogin 在自动化爬虫与数据采集任务中展现出的指纹伪装兼容性与防封能力

“数据为王”已成为企业竞争的现实。电商定价监控、广告情报抓取、舆情与竞品分析,这些任务都依赖大规模、实时的数据采集。

然而,平台的反爬虫机制愈发复杂:五秒盾、人机验证、403 拒绝响应不断升级,简单的代理池或虚拟机早已力不从心。许多团队即使投入高昂成本,也依旧面临频繁掉线和任务中断。

在这种环境下,VMLogin 以其指纹伪装与环境隔离能力脱颖而出,为自动化采集提供了更接近真实用户的访问表现,从而显著降低封禁率,提升稳定性。


为什么传统方案难以支撑大规模采集?

一个典型场景是电商价格监控。团队需要每小时抓取数万条商品数据,起初依靠代理池和 Selenium 并发请求,结果不到一周,大量代理被封,采集成功率跌到 60% 以下。尝试用虚拟机扩展节点,问题又变成资源消耗过高、维护困难。

主要挑战包括:

  • IP 重用导致集体封禁:多个任务使用相同代理,一旦被标记,整体任务失败。
  • 指纹高度一致:同一浏览器环境下的 Canvas、WebRTC、字体渲染特征过于统一,极易触发识别。
  • 行为轨迹不自然:请求模式过于机械,缺乏滚动、延迟和交互,触发风控。
  • 虚拟化痕迹暴露:虚拟机的底层特征容易被检测,降低成功率。

归根结底,传统方式无法在规模化场景中保持低成本与高成功率的平衡。

8c4fe78d 0774 4f26 a9c9 fac116aa9666

VMLogin 的核心优势

VMLogin 的价值可归纳为两大支点:环境多样化行为拟真化。这让每个采集节点都表现得像真实用户,而不是批量化脚本。

  • 多维度指纹伪装
    随机或自定义显卡型号、分辨率、字体渲染、插件列表、Canvas 输出与 WebRTC 行为,极大增加了环境的独特性。
  • 独立环境隔离
    每个任务运行在单独的浏览器配置文件中,Cookies、LocalStorage 和缓存完全独立,避免任务之间互相污染。
  • 代理与系统参数匹配
    支持为不同环境绑定独立代理,并同步调整语言和时区,实现“IP、地理位置、系统设置”一致化。
  • 拟人化操作支持
    通过延迟、滚动、鼠标移动和资源加载顺序调整,让访问行为更像真实用户,而非机器人。
  • 轻量化并发
    相比虚拟机,VMLogin 运行轻便,可在同样硬件上支持数倍并发,降低整体运维成本。

实战案例与对比数据

案例 A — 电商监控团队

  • 传统方案:公共代理 + 单一脚本模板,封禁率高达 35%,采集成功率仅 65%。
  • VMLogin 方案:独立环境 + 随机化指纹 + 健康代理池,封禁率下降至 6%,成功率提升至 94%。

案例 B — 广告采集公司

  • 传统方案:全球广告落地页采集,区域代理频繁被封,部分市场数据缺失严重。
  • VMLogin 方案:为每个地区配置本地代理与本地语言时区,覆盖率从 70% 提升到 96%。

案例 C — 舆情监控机构

  • 传统方案:高并发集中请求,频繁触发验证码与 429 错误。
  • VMLogin 方案:任务拆分至多个小环境,结合动态指纹与限速策略,连续三个月稳定运行,异常率控制在 3% 以下。

这些对比数据表明,VMLogin 在企业级采集中不仅能提升成功率,更能让系统运行更稳定、成本更可控。


如何在自动化框架中接入 VMLogin

VMLogin 通常与 Selenium、Puppeteer 或 Playwright 配合使用,关键步骤包括:

  1. 环境调用:通过 VMLogin 创建并保存浏览器环境,自动化脚本直接调用该环境启动任务。
  2. 代理分配:为不同环境绑定独立代理,结合健康检查机制自动替换失效代理。
  3. 指纹池化:提前准备多套指纹模板,随机分配给不同任务,避免同质化。
  4. 行为随机化:在采集过程中加入延时、滚动、点击、悬浮等操作,减少“机器人模式”的痕迹。
  5. 日志与回退机制:记录每次访问的状态码与失败原因,出现 403/429 时自动切换代理或延迟重试。

这种接入方式让 VMLogin 成为“底层防护层”,开发者专注业务逻辑,无需反复修补爬虫。


风险与合规考量

VMLogin 的能力在于降低技术性封禁,但并不意味着可以规避法律和平台规则。合规始终是前提:

  • 遵守 robots.txt 与目标平台的服务条款;
  • 控制访问频率,避免给对方系统带来负担;
  • 在可能的情况下,优先选择官方 API 或经过授权的数据获取方式;
  • 针对敏感数据和区域,确保符合当地法律法规。

长期稳定的数据采集,必须以合规为前提。


企业级运维与成本优化

要在企业级规模下保持稳定,建议采纳以下实践:

  1. 代理池健康监控:实时检测延迟与成功率,剔除劣质代理。
  2. 指纹模板动态更新:避免长时间使用相同模板,降低被识别的风险。
  3. 任务分区调度:将大规模任务拆分为多个小任务,分时分段执行。
  4. 异常趋势预警:当验证码或 403 错误突然增多时,自动减速或切换环境。
  5. 集中日志分析:通过日志识别失败模式,快速优化策略。

这些措施能降低长期维护成本,让团队从“救火式修复”转向“稳定性运营”。


常见问题解答(FAQ)

1. VMLogin 能完全避免封禁吗?

不能完全避免,但能显著降低封禁率,提升采集稳定性。

2. 是否必须配合代理使用?

建议是。高质量独立代理与指纹伪装结合,才能发挥最大效果。

3. 能否与主流框架无缝配合?

可以。VMLogin 环境可直接被 Selenium、Puppeteer、Playwright 调用。

4. 会不会占用大量资源?

不会。相比虚拟机,VMLogin 更轻量化,可在同等硬件上运行更多环境。

5. 如何判断采集已被检测?

常见信号包括:响应延迟明显增加、验证码频繁出现、403/429 错误激增。应立即调整策略。


随着平台反爬虫和风控机制不断升级,传统的“代理池 + 虚拟机”组合越来越难以满足企业级需求。VMLogin 通过指纹伪装、环境隔离与轻量化并发,让每个采集环境更像真实用户,从而显著提升任务稳定性。

未来,平台的检测手段将更加智能,粗暴的高并发采集会被快速识别并阻断。拟真化、分布式与合规化的采集方式,才是长期发展的正解。VMLogin 正在成为这一趋势下的关键工具,帮助企业把数据优势转化为真正的竞争力。